If you've been following me for a minute, you know that I have a love/hate relationship with #authres (authentic resources). Mostly, I love them...but I hate how they are often used and suggested/enforced to be used in low level classes.

Authentic resources are only as valuable as the language acquisition that they foster. If you are going to go through all of the time and trouble to locate an engaging, relevant #authres, design an activity that your students can complete successfully, and then dedicate class time to it...well, it sure as heck better make your students more proficient! To that end, I use a simple, three-step process whenever I want to use an authentic resource with my novices:

  1. Introduce the content and/or themes of the resource
  2. Create an activity that allows students to successfully interact with the resource
  3.  Further investigate the content and/or themes of the resource through personalized discussion and cultural exploration
